Takoradi, Feb. 27, GNA - The people of Sekondi-Takoradi have received the State of the Nation Address, delivered by President John Mahama to Parliament, with mixed reaction.

Many of the people the GNA interviewed expressed little or no hope in seeing a transformed economy in the near future, others were of the view that things could improve should the people support the Government to prosecute its developmental agenda.

While some blamed the government for mishandling the economy, others put the blame for the economic challenges on individual misdeeds that had they believed had culminated to hurt the nation.

Mr. James Kweku Darku, lauded the Government for the various policy interventions, aimed at addressing the economic problems, and encouraged it to do more in the Energy Sector to save industries and businesses.

He said when productivity declines, the national economy would suffer and called for pragmatic solutions through scientific innovations to solve the energy crisis.

Madam Yaba, for part, said, 'God is my Sufficiency and it is only with the help of God that Ghana can break through.'

Madam Aba Yaa, a pawpaw seller, called on the Government and state institutions to eliminate corruption and its related tendencies and encouraged hard work and dedication to duty.

Ms. Ernestina Adjei, a restaurant operator, also called for the adoption of a positive attitude among Ghanaians towards growing the local economy.

Mr. Isaac Obosu, a staff of the Geological Survey Department, commended the Government but entreated it to improve upon working conditions in the public sector to maximize productivity.

The President announced various interventions to solve the problems regarding Health, Education, Social Protection, Energy, Roads, Infrastructure, Water, Corruption, and other national problems.
